Types of Edc Screwdrivers
Edc screwdrivers come in a variety of types, each designed for specific tasks and preferences. The most common types include pocket screwdrivers, keychain screwdrivers, and multitool screwdrivers. Pocket screwdrivers are compact and lightweight, making them easy to carry in a pocket or purse. Keychain screwdrivers are attached to a keychain, providing a convenient and accessible tool. Multitool screwdrivers combine a screwdriver with other functions, such as a knife, pliers, or bottle opener.
When choosing an Edc screwdriver, it’s essential to consider the type that best fits your needs. If you’re looking for a simple and compact tool, a pocket screwdriver may be the best option. If you want a tool that can be easily attached to your keys, a keychain screwdriver is a great choice. For those who want a more versatile tool, a multitool screwdriver is an excellent option.
In addition to these types, there are also Edc screwdrivers with specialized features, such as a screwdriver with a built-in LED light or a screwdriver with a magnetic tip. These features can be useful in specific situations, such as working in low-light environments or dealing with small screws.
Some Edc screwdrivers also come with interchangeable bits, allowing you to adapt the tool to different tasks and screws. This feature can be particularly useful for those who work with a variety of screws and fasteners.

Edc Screwdriver Materials and Construction
Edc screwdrivers are made from a variety of materials,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. The most common materials used in Edc screwdrivers include stainless steel, titanium, and aluminum. Stainless steel is a popular choice due to its strength, corrosion resistance, and affordability. Titanium is also widely used, offering a strong and lightweight option with excellent corrosion resistance.
The construction of an Edc screwdriver is also an essential factor to consider. A well-made Edc screwdriver should have a sturdy handle, a durable shaft, and a reliable tip. The handle should be ergonomic and comfortable to grip, while the shaft should be strong and resistant to bending or breaking. The tip should be precision-made to ensure a secure fit in screws and other fasteners.
In addition to the materials and construction, the finish of an Edc screwdriver is also important. A high-quality finish can provide a smooth and comfortable grip, while also protecting the tool from corrosion and wear. Some common finishes used in Edc screwdrivers include anodizing, powder coating, and polishing.
When evaluating the materials and construction of an Edc screwdriver, it’s essential to consider the intended use and environment. For example, if you plan to use the screwdriver in a harsh or corrosive environment, you may want to choose a tool made from stainless steel or titanium. If you prioritize weight and portability, aluminum or titanium may be a better option.

-drive Type and Compatibility
The drive type and compatibility of an EDC screwdriver are essential factors to consider, as they will determine what types of screws you can drive. The most common drive types are flathead, Phillips, and Torx,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. Consider the types of screws you are most likely to encounter and choose a screwdriver that matches those needs. Additionally, some EDC screwdrivers feature interchangeable bits or adapters, which can expand their compatibility with different drive types.
When evaluating the drive type and compatibility of an EDC screwdriver, consider the trade-offs between versatility and simplicity. A screwdriver with multiple drive types or interchangeable bits may be more convenient, but may also be bulkier or more complex to use. On the other hand, a simple screwdriver with a single drive type may be more intuitive to use, but may limit its applicability. How do I care for and maintain my EDC screwdriver?
To care for and maintain your EDC screwdriver, you should start by cleaning it regularly to remove any dirt or debris that may accumulate. You can use a soft cloth and mild soap to wipe down the screwdriver, and av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that may damage the finish. You should also apply a small amount of oil or lubricant to the moving parts, such as the hinge or pivot point, to keep them running smoothly.
In addition to regular cleaning and maintenance, you should also store your EDC screwdriver properly to protect it from damage. This may involve keeping it in a protective case or pouch, or attaching it to a keychain or lanyard to prevent it from getting lost. By taking good care of your EDC screwdriver, you can help extend its lifespan and ensure that it continues to function properly when you need it. Regular maintenance can also help prevent rust or corrosion, and keep the screwdriver looking its best.
